Charade Profile

Charade is a 6 year old bay mare. Charade is trained by W A Bogarts, at Morphettville and owned by Mrs J R Bogarts & B W Bogarts.

Charade’s last race event was at 13/12/2020 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Charade Racing Form

Career form is wins, seconds, 2 thirds from 19 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$7,080.

With a 0% Win Percentage and 11% Place Percentage. Charade's last race event was at Bordertown.

Exposed form for its last starts is 7-9-0-5-9.
